June 27, 2022 Referendum

This referendum took place on June 27, 2022. This referendum pertained to whether or not to pass Constitutional Amendment II, which removed the arbitrary polling place requirement, and to make some changes to how elections work, and Constitutional Amendment III, which allowed another government official to take a senator’s place if they are unavailable for a senate meeting.

Results

Both amendments passed unanimously
